This exceptional 36,000-square-foot industrial building, situated on a 2.72-acre lot in Kendallville, Indiana, presents a significant opportunity. Built in 1980, this single-story structure boasts a 13-14 foot ceiling height, ideal for various manufacturing needs. The property features four dock-high doors (three with levelers, one without), and one drive-in door, ensuring efficient loading and unloading. Power is supplied by a robust 1200 Amp/480 Volt/3-phase system. Ample on-site parking is available for employees and visitors. The building's layout includes a main area with 30 x 50 column spacing and an addition with 50 x 25 column spacing, offering flexibility for diverse operational setups. The interior features a fully sprinklered system, fluorescent lighting, gas forced-air heat in the warehouse, and central air conditioning in the office space. Office amenities include two private offices, a conference room, a large open area suitable for cubicles, and separate men's and women's restrooms. The property is zoned I-2 High Intensity Industrial, allowing for a wide range of manufacturing uses. Its location on N 400 E St & County Rd 700 N offers convenient access, approximately 15 miles west of I-69 and 23 miles south of I-80/90. The building is currently entirely vacant. The property's APN is 57-04-35-400-005.000-010. Kendallville offers a desirable location with excellent parks, recreational facilities, schools, and a historic downtown area.
